Took the old girl to the dyno today. He was chasing a weird issue where the MAF signal was all over the place for a second and then fine the next. Best he can tell, I don't have my inner fenders in yet, he thinks the air turbulence around the air filter is causing issues when driving. It only happens for a split second a very low speed and throttle percentage. I am going to put the fenders back in and take it back next week to see if that solves my issue.

Ok, for the number. This was a loaded dyno in 2nd gear, so the numbers are skewed. He does second gear because 3rd is almost 150mph on my setup and he didn't want to spit the driveshaft. Loaded dyno reads 15% lower.

344rwhp@5750 / 345ftlbs@4350 which translates to about 396rwhp on a dynojet. Keep in mind this is in 2nd gear, so actualy hp/tq numbers are a smidge higher. This is close to my 500hp at the crank goal.

All I can say is this thing moves out. It hardly spins the tires, squats, and goes!
